#0cd34c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0cd34c is composed of 4.7% red, 82.7%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 64%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 139.3 degrees, a saturation of 89.2% and a lightness of 43.7%. #0cd34c color hex could be obtained by blending #18ff98 with #00a700.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

Shades and Tints of #0cd34c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000702 is the darkest color, while #f3fef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0cd34c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a756e is the less saturated color, while #03dc49 is the most saturated one.
